A man believed to be in his 40’s was shot and killed by police officers responding to a domestic dispute after he allegedly opened fire on police in the Fairhill section of the city yesterday.

A report from 6-ABC Action News said the shooting happened on the 2900 block of Lawrence Street at around 6:00 p.m. on Friday evening.

According to police, the unnamed suspect began firing at police officers as soon as they stepped out of their police cruisers. Four officers returned fire before the suspect jumped into one of the police vehicles.

The suspect was rushed to a nearby hospital where he died shortly after arriving. No police officers were injured during the shooting. Police said the weapon used by the suspect was found inside one of the police cars.
